ChatGPT-4 for detecting surgical site infections after colorectal surgery
Part of Infections clinical trials.
This trial tests whether ChatGPT-4 can help detect surgical site infections after colorectal surgery by looking at your electronic health records. It aims to improve infection monitoring without extra tests or visits.
Summary written for real people, not researchers, by Clin2.
Who can take part
- You are scheduled for a planned colorectal surgery (not an emergency).
- You do not have an active infection at the time of the operation.
- You do not have an existing intestinal stoma (a surgically created opening in your belly).
